Other well-known names of the syndrome include; 5p minus, 5p monosomy, and Lejeune’s Syndrome. The words Cri Du Chat translate in French to “cry of the cat,” this is referring to the distinct cry of children burdened by this disorder.

Is a chromosomal condition that results when a piece of chromosome 5 is missing; People diagnosed with cri du chat tend to have distinctive facial features; Occurs in an estimated 1 in 20,000 to 50,000 newborns WebSince the discovery, in 1956, of the normal human chromosome number, four clinical syndromes associated with autosomal anomalies have been described. Lejeune, in 1963 (8), first recognized the cri du chat or “cat's cry” syndrome which is the most recently appreciated of the four autosomal syndromes and the subject of this paper. Cri-du-chat (cat's cry) syndrome, also known as 5p- (5p minus) syndrome, is a chromosomal condition that results when a piece of chromosome 5 is missing.
